Singaporean delegation calls on Al Habtoor Group to discuss business ties

Khalaf Al Habtoor, Chairman, Al Habtoor Group welcomed a high-profile delegation from Singapore at the Group head office on Sunday, March 3rd.
Present from the Al Habtoor Group were Mohammed Al Habtoor, Vice Chairman and CEO; Paul Rayner, Advisor to the Chairman, Sanjeev Agarwala, Director Strategy & Business Development. The delegation included His Excellency Umej Bhatia, Ambassador, Embassy of the Republic of Singapore in Abu Dhabi; Cheong Ming Foong, Consul-General, Republic of Singapore in Dubai; Lester Lu, Consul (Commercial) and Regional Director, Middle East & Africa Group, International Enterprise Singapore; Khalil A. Bakar, Centre Director, Singapore Economic Development Board; Mohamed Hafez Marican, Area Director Middle East & Africa.
The meeting focused on synergies between the United Arab Emirates and Singapore and potential collaboration and investment opportunities for both parties.
Khalaf Al Habtoor said, “Singapore is a good model, it is at the heart of Asia’s economy. It is a story of great success. Like the UAE, it has emerged as a financial and trading hub serving the region and it has transformed itself into at world class metropolis. There are many synergies between us that we can both capitalize on.”
International Enterprise (IE) Singapore is a government agency driving Singapore’s external economy and promoting international trade, the backbone of Singapore’s economy.
Singapore EDB meanwhile is the lead government agency for planning and executing strategies to enhance Singapore’s position as a global business centre.

Al Habtoor Group
The Al Habtoor Group has grown with the United Arab Emirates. What started out as a small engineering firm in 1970, is today one of the region’s most respected conglomerates with interests in the hospitality, automotive, real estate, education and publishing sectors. The Al Habtoor Group has earned itself a solid reputation both locally and internationally due to the vision of its Chairman, Khalaf Ahmad Al Habtoor.
